Ondansetron
Indications/Uses
Management of nausea & vomiting induced by cytotoxic chemotherapy & RT. Prevention of post-op nausea & vomiting.
Dosage/Direction for Use
Adult Emetogenic chemotherapy & RT 8 mg twice daily 1-2 hr before treatment, followed by 8 mg orally 12 hr later. Highly emetogenic chemotherapy (eg, high dose cisplatin) 24 mg taken together w/ oral dexamethasone Na phosphate 12 mg, 1-2 hr before treatment. Protection against delayed or prolonged emesis after the 1st 24 hr: Treatment should be continued for up to 5 days after a course of treatment. Childn 5 mg/m2 as a single dose immediately before chemotherapy, followed by 4 mg orally 12 hr later. 4 mg orally twice daily should be continued for up to 5 days after a course of treatment. Adult doses must not be exceeded. Patient w/ hepatic impairment Max total daily dose: 8 mg. Post-op nausea & vomiting Adult Prevention: 8 mg given 1 hr prior to anaesth. Followed by further dosage of 8 mg at 8 hr intervals, alternatively 4 mg single dose may be given at induction on anaesth. Treatment: 4 mg single dose. Patient w/ hepatic impairment Max total daily dose: 8 mg.
Administration
May be taken with or without food: Place the oral dissolving film on top of the tongue, where it will disperse w/in sec, then swallow. Do not drink water.

Special Precautions
Patients w/ hypersensitivity to other selective 5-HT3 receptor antagonists. Prolonged transient ECG changes including QT interval prolongation. Monitor patients w/ signs of subacute intestinal obstruction following administration. Not recommended during pregnancy. Mothers should not breast-feed during treatment.
Adverse Reactions
Headache. Warmth or flushing sensation; constipation, local burning sensation following insertion of supp; local IV inj site reactions (in patients receiving chemotherapy w/ cisplatin).
Drug Interactions
Increased oral clearance & decreased blood conc w/ potent CYP3A4 inducers (eg, phenytoin, carbamazepine, rifampicin). May reduce analgesic effect of tramadol.
